Top 10 Benefits of Learning DevOps

Today’s companies in the software industry focus on getting high-speed work, high quality, and great teamwork, not only the code. That is why DevOps is needed. DevOps is created when Development and Operations work together, making it more than hype and implementing this approach results in faster, stable software delivery. How does that apply to you? Many people see better performance, gain more opportunities, and progress further in their careers once they learn DevOps course in Chandigarh.

 

1. Faster Development and Deployment

DevOps mainly focuses on making software delivery go faster. DevOps uses automation to get new releases out in a matter of hours, rather than letting them take days or even weeks.

This change enables developers to be more productive by spending less time on waiting and more time creating new things. For companies, it allows them to act quickly to new trends in the market.

 

2. Better Collaboration Between Teams

In most cases, different developer and operations teams did not interact closely. Programmers created the code, and ops took care of setting it up. As a result, slowdowns, misunderstandings, or trouble regularly happened. The use of DevOps allows people to cooperate and always be in communication with one another. Git, Jenkins, and Docker are technologies as well as tools that help teams unify their efforts instead of working independently.

 

3. High Demand in the Job Market

The need for DevOps experts is increasing all over the world. Startups, big enterprises, and other organizations are on the lookout for people with DevOps skills.

Why DevOps skills make you more employable:

  • Now, companies tend to choose candidates who can master code as well as infrastructure.
  • Nowadays, DevOps skills fit well with top cloud services such as AWS, Azure, and Google Cloud.
  • People with the skills to be “DevOps Engineers,” “Site Reliability Engineers,” or “Cloud DevOps Specialists” are hired quickly and are usually offered high wages.

 

4. Continuous Integration and Continuous Delivery (CI/CD)

One must know about CI/CD pipelines in DevOps because they play a key role in modern software engineering. As a result, code changes are automatically checked and released, bringing down the number of software flaws and making the code better. Even if you have little experience, knowing about these practices gives you more confidence and allows you to do projects well and quickly.

 

5. Real-Time Problem Solving and Monitoring

Popular tools for DevOps monitoring are usually Nagios, Prometheus, and Grafana. They make it possible for teams to find problems as they come up, sometimes earning them praise from users.

With DevOps skills, you can:

  • Make sure to keep an eye on the application’s performance.
  • Pay attention to lag and bad graphics such that catching bugs becomes easier.
  • Cut down on lost income and make customers happier.

Having this skill matters a lot when you constantly need to address issues quickly.

 

6. Improved Career Flexibility

DevOps can be done by people from different roles. If you gain experience with its rules and resources, you are ready for different tasks, including becoming one of the following:

  • Cloud Architect
  • Automation Engineer
  • Infrastructure Developer
  • DevSecOps Specialist

It is also possible to move between industries without much difficulty since DevOps is applied in finance, healthcare, e-commerce, and other areas.

 

7. Stronger Foundation in Modern Technologies

Being DevOps means you have to handle various tools with actual use.

  • Git is an example of a version control system.
  • Other special resources, like Docker and Kubernetes
  • Examples of cloud services are AWS, GCP, and Azure
  • Infrastructure as Code (IaC) can be done with Terraform or Ansible

 

In today’s job market, IT specialists depend on these technologies, and DevOps organizes them.

 

8. Enhanced Software Quality

DevOps stresses on reviewing code and testing it often, allowing problems to be found at an early step. Because of this, there are fewer chances of bugs in production and the software is better quality. It helps teams avoid the need for repeating certain steps. For people using these paths, it results in easier and more dependable applications.

 

9. Cost Efficiency for Organizations

Thanks to automating tasks and simplifying processes, DevOps cuts expenses and reduces the time needed for work. So, you should become a person who can help organizations use their resources wisely and still ensure high quality. Smaller as well as larger companies can make use of DevOps, so this skill is applicable to all types of organizations.

 

10. A Growth-Oriented Mindset

Learning and improvement should be a big part of what DevOps is all about. DevOps aims to grow people and systems by encouraging changes, learning from them, and being flexible.

 

Conclusion

Being a part of DevOps is an intelligent step for any person aiming to work in tech. It merges development, operations, cloud, automation, and teamwork into an important skillset. With DevOps, you can succeed in any stage of your career, both today and ahead. As well as creating better systems, it will strengthen your position as a member of a team, a solution-seeker, and someone who can succeed in their field.

 

Leave a Reply

Your email address will not be published. Required fields are marked *